1. Pre-heat your oven to 350°F (180°C) then line an 8x4 inch loaf tin, set aside.
2. In a large bowl whisk together the pumpkin puree, eggs, coconut oil and Lakanto maple syrup.
3. In a separate bowl combine the coconut fl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t, nutmeg and cinnamon.
4. Add the dry ingredients into the wet and mix until a thick, even batter is formed.

1. Pour one cup almond milk into a small bowl. Sprinkle gelatin on top. Allow to sit, undisturbed for about 5 minutes to allow gelatin to bloom.
2. Meanwhile. in a medium saucepan, whisk together the granulated stevia/erythritol blend and the eggs. Whisk in pumpkin and pumpkin spice. After gelatin has bloomed, whisk in gelatin.
3. Bring the mixture just to a simmer, then remove from heat. Allow to cool about 5 minutes at room temperature, then cool in the refrigerator, uncovered for 45 minutes. stirring occasionally. Do not cool too long or the mixture will set.
4. Remove pumpkin mixture from the refrigerator and whisk in heavy cream and remaining cup of almond milk. Pour mixture into an ice-cream freezer and freeze according to manufactures instructions.

What is low carb low sugar pumpkin bread?

So the main ingredients in this low carb low sugar pumpkin bread are pumpkin, eggs, coconut flour, spices, Lakanto maple syrup and coconut oil. The bread is made in one bowl by combing the wet ingredients, then the dry, then putting the two together.
